Thailand looks forward to more Chinese enterprises investing in Thailand

release time:2023/11/9

People's Daily Online, Bangkok, November 8 (Reporter Sun Guangyong) In recent years, China Thailand economic and trade relations have achieved all-round and leapfrog development. China has been Thailand's largest trading partner for 10 consecutive years. More and more Chinese enterprises have taken advantage of the "the Belt and Road" to take root in Thailand, ushering in a new period of opportunity for China Thailand economic and trade cooperation. At the end of 2018, China National Petroleum Pipeline Engineering Co., Ltd. established the Southeast Asian Design Consulting Center in Bangkok, Thailand, mainly engaged in design consulting business in the energy engineering field, belonging to the high-end technology field of the industry. For the past five years, the center has adhered to a localized development model, providing nearly 100 positions for Thai engineers, and through global collaborative design, allowing them to participate more in energy projects undertaken by pipeline design institutes in the Middle East, Southeast Asia, Africa and other regions, cultivating international technical and management talents for Thailand.
In recent years, the Southeast Asian Design Consulting Center has undertaken a number of engineering design projects in Thailand, including the Northeast Product Oil Pipeline and the Xingang Project. The number of employees in Thailand has increased from a few dozen to over a hundred. In order to accelerate business development, the center actively leverages its local advantages and introduces high-level foreign outstanding management talents to important positions such as project director, department manager, and project manager.

During the operation process, Chinese enterprises adhere to the concept of "people-oriented" and have set up more than 20 sets of different types of training courses for Thai employees. Regular job technical skills training is carried out every month to improve skill levels.
